In molecular biology, a transcription factor (TF) (or sequence-specific DNA-binding factor) is a protein that controls the rate of transcription of genetic information from DNA to messenger RNA, by binding to a specific DNA sequence. General transcription factors plus RNA polymerase and another protein complex called the mediator multiple protein complex constitute the basic transcriptional apparatus, which positions RNA polymerase right at the start of a protein coding sequence or a gene and then releases the polymerase to transcribe the messenger RNA from that DNA template. Other examples of transcription factors that contain zinc finger domains are the steroid hormone receptors, which regulate gene transcription in response to hormones such as estrogen and testosterone. The CREB and CREM transcription factors are activated by phosphorylation of a key serine residue by kinases stimulated by cyclic AMP, Ca2+,growth factors and stress signals. In case of e. coli, promotor consists of two conserved sequences 5'-TTGACA-3' at -35 element and 5'-TATAAT-3' at -10 element.
